Transaction 95e4ddf5d576dd36cc6c9f994df1501c41b2c7f96c4684a9ea78dbde9b34e697
1 Input
2 Outputs
- 95e4ddf5d576dd36cc6c9f994df1501c41b2c7f96c4684a9ea78dbde9b34e697:0
- 95e4ddf5d576dd36cc6c9f994df1501c41b2c7f96c4684a9ea78dbde9b34e697:1
value 74120721
address mi4VFiRFvuSN3Fet1dzEVA5F3YmNYaVmdx
value 5000000
address n356fv13BfCvuQ5E5UUiG8Rh7nxUkuFesm